Air Service Updates: Safford Gets Route to PHX
The City of Safford started airline service for the first time in 50 years when Grand Canyon Airlines kicked off its route to Phoenix Sky Harbor Jan. 6. The airport last had air service in 1974.
This project is funded through the Small Community Air Service Development Program and a grant from Freeport-McMoRan Mining, whose global headquarters is next to PHX.
Safford is the county seat of Graham County in eastern Arizona and is about an hour flight away.
Other upcoming routes as mentioned in last month’s issue of PHX Check-In:
- Allegiant begins nonstop service between Phoenix and Pittsburgh Feb. 7.
- American Airlines will add service to McClellan-Palomar Airport (CLD) in Carlsbad, California, beginning Feb. 13, 2025. American's regional affiliate Envoy Air will operate twice-daily flights to Phoenix Sky Harbor International Airport, marketed as American Eagle service.
- Southwest Airlines starts redeye service for the first time in five markets. Phoenix is one of those markets with service to Baltimore/Washington starting Feb. 13.
- American Airlines announced they will be serving Appleton, Wisconsin starting Feb. 15. This route, which will be operated by American Eagle affiliate Envoy Air on board an Embraer E175 regional jet, will run on Saturdays.
- Frontier Airlines will start twice weekly service between Phoenix and Austin-Bergstrom on March 7.
- Starting March 30, 2025, Aeromexico will connect Phoenix and Mexico City International Airport with daily service. Aeromexico will fly Boeing 737 MAX aircraft.
